Suspected diesel smuggling along Sg Miri

The three Indonesian men arrested following the seizure of RM318,370 worth of diesel oil.

MIRI, Nov 11: Three Indonesian men have been arrested following a seizure of 5,500 litre of diesel worth RM318,370 in Miri.

Sarawak Marine Police Region Five commander ACP Shamsol Kassim said the arrests were made after a team from the Marine Police Region Five stopped a suspicious tugboat along Sungai Miri.

He said a huge amount of diesel was found to be kept in a compartment at the bottom of the vessel.

“The Three Indonesian men on the vessel failed to produce any valid documentation or permit from the Domestic Trade and Consumer Affairs Ministry (KPDNHEP) during the inspection,” he said.

The men and the seized merchandise were handed over to KPDNHEP Miri for further action.

The case is being investigate under Section 20(1) of the Control of Supplies Act 1961. — DayakDaily
